Recreation notes

Working knowledge that has no schema field yet — edition differences, tuning values, pitfalls.

Coverage: partial - machine identity plus candidate-only I/O attachments. Playfield devices, wiring, mechanisms, and behavior are evidenced only as unverified candidates.

This record was promoted from the generated catalog stub stub.pinmame.lostspc by the catalog-wide identity pass of 2026-08-29. The promotion resolves machine identity and carries the catalog's residual driver grouping over unchanged, the platform and device attachments below were added by the 2026-08-29/30 candidate passes and assert nothing beyond candidate provenance. Every requirement in the definition's coverage.missing is genuinely outstanding.

Identity

  • PinMAME catalog: root driver lostspc, description "Lost in Space (1.01, Display 1.02)", manufacturer "Sega", catalog year "1998".
  • OPDB record GR91x-MLBZE (IPDB 4442) names this machine "Lost In Space" (Sega, manufacture date 1998-05-01); the resolved identity rests on the agreement of the PinMAME catalog and this reviewed mapping.
  • The definition's driver list is exactly the clone tree PinMAME declares under lostspc; whether every listed driver really runs on this physical machine is unverified.

Drivers this record holds

  • lostspc (1998, Sega).
  • lostspc1 (1998, Sega, clone of lostspc).
  • lostspcf (1998, Sega, clone of lostspc).
  • lostspcg (1998, Sega, clone of lostspc).

VPX script candidates (candidate)

  • 1 retained community table script(s) declare this machine's driver; their extracted switch/lamp/solenoid/GI candidates are carried as 89 candidate devices. When curator work weighs sources, a retained script outranks emulator-derived candidates for runtime semantics, but every device here is still a candidate until a known-working table is verified against this exact physical machine.

What a curator must establish next

Controller platform from the pinned PinMAME driver source; full input, output, and display enumeration with semantic names; physical wiring and polarity; mechanism inventory and behavior; variant differences across the clone tree; recreation knowledge from a manual, schematic, or known-working table; runtime provenance; and a normalized spatial placement for every physical device. No manual, schematic, or runtime-harness evidence is retained for this machine yet; the candidate sections above are the only retained I/O evidence so far.
